Helen’s Heart Love is from God – 1 John 4:7 God created us to love. The more love we give, the more we have to offer. The Holy Spirit sheds abroad the love of God in our hearts that we can radiate to others. If you find yourself dried up in this area, find the fresh springs in Jesus – the more we love Him, most certainly, we shall love others. He energizes us with His new command, “to love one another, as I have loved you.”
